A tragic incident unfolded in the Lar area as Mukhtar Sahni, a contractual lineman, lost his life due to electrocution. On Sunday, while working on a transformer, electricity was unexpectedly restored, causing a fatal accident.

Shahni's body remained suspended for three hours following the incident. Villagers had alerted local law enforcement, but the lack of immediate response from electricity department officials delayed the recovery process.

Eventually, Naib Tehsildar and other officials were able to retrieve the body, which was sent for post-mortem examination. This incident highlights the critical safety gaps and communication issues within the electricity department.
